In vivo studies of G. lucidum.

No. Animal Form Dosage (mg/kg) Antioxidant parameters Biological activity Pathway References
1 CCl4-induced acute liver injury mice GLPS 100 - 150 NOS CYP2E1 MDA, GSH Suppressing free radical lipid peroxidation Decreasing of the protein expression levels of NLRP3, ASC, and caspase-1 in acute liver injury.
ASC (apoptosis-associated speck-like protein)
NLRP3 (NOD-like receptor 3)
Caspase-1
GAPDH (glyceraldehyde-3-phosphate hydrogenase
[22]

2 Croton oil applied skin edema in rats Ethanol extract of sporocarps 500 and 1000 mg/kg Antiperoxidative, anti-inflammatory, and antimutagenic activities Direct anti-inflammatory and free radical scavenging properties of the extract [23]

3 Photoreceptor cell lesions induced by N-methyl-N-nitrosourea (MNU) in female SD arts Ganoderma spore lipid (GSL) 500, 1000, 2000, and 4000 mg/kg Expressions of Bax, Bcl-xl, and caspase-3 Improve A-wave amplitude (μv) decreased apoptosis levels Regulate the expressions of Bax, Bcl-xl, and caspases-3, inhibiting MNU-induced rat, photoreceptor cell apoptosis, and protecting retinal function [30]

4 A carotid-artery-ligation mouse model Ganoderma triterpenoid (GT) 300 mg/kg/day Intimal hyperplasia structural changes VCAM-1, TNF-α, and IL-6 Atheroprotective properties Endothelin-1, von Willebrand factor, and monocyte chemoattractant protein-1 [33]

5 Swimming-induced oxidative stress in skeletal muscle mice GLPS 50, 100, and 200 mg/kg SOD, GPX, and CAT activities as well as by the MDA levels Attenuates exercise-induced oxidative stress in skeletal muscle Increasing antioxidant enzyme activities and decrease the MDA levels. Protective effects against exhaustive exercise-induced oxidative stress [32]

6 Rat gastric cancer model GLPS 400-800 mg/kg for 20 weeks SOD, CAT, and GSH-Px Antioxidant Induced the levels of serum IL-6 and TNF-α levels and increased the levels of serum IL-2, IL-4, and IL-10 in GLP-treated rats compared to gastric cancer model rats [37]

7 BALB/c female mice GLPS i.p. daily 50 mg/kg, 100 mg/kg, and 200 mg/kg SOD and GSH-Px Antioxidant Improved immunity in mice. Increased thymus and spleen index; improved SOD and GSH-Px contents in the mice body [31]

8 T2DM rats GLPS 200, 400, and 800 mg × kg−1 for 16 weeks NO, SOD, MDA, GSH-Px, and CAT MDA in cardiac tissue Antioxidation in cardiac tissue of T2DM rats Reduce MDA in cardiac tissue and improve the myocardial ultrastructure [34]

9 Male BALB/c mice (age19-21 months) (aged mice) Ethanolic extract of G. lucidum 50 and 250 mg/kg, once daily for 15 days GSH Mn-SOD, GPx, and GST Antioxidant in heart tissues Elevated the levels of GSH as well as activities of MnSOD, GPx, and GST and decreased significantly the levels of lipid peroxidation, AOPP, and ROS. Improve the age-related decline of antioxidant status which was partly ascribed to free radical scavenging activity [38]

10 B16 mouse melanoma Methanol extract containing total terpenoids (GLme) and a purified methanol extract containing mainly acidic terpenoids (GLpme) A daily i.p. injection of 100 mg/kg body weight (b.w.) Production of oxygen radical caspase-dependent apoptotic cell death-mediated production of reactive oxygen species Anticancer The mechanism of antitumor activity of GLme comprised inhibition of cell proliferation and induction of caspase-dependent apoptotic cell death mediated by upregulated p53 and inhibited Bcl-2 expression [86]

11 With non-insulin-dependent diabetes mellitus (NIDDM) Ganoderma lucidum spores 250 mg/kg × d, for 10 Xanthine oxidase (XOD), myeloperoxidase (MPO), and mitochondrial succinate dehydrogenase (SDH) in the testis Reducing free radical-induceddamage to the testicular tissue Protect the testis of diabetic rats by reducing free radical-induced damage to the testicular tissue and enhancing the activity of SDH [35]

12 Epididymal cells of type 2 diabetes rats Ganoderma lucidum spores (GLS) 250 mg/kg × d, for 10 weeks Contents of mitochondrial calcium & cytochrome C Antipoptosis induced by DM Protect epididymal cells and counteract their apoptosis in diabetic condition [36]

13 Liver tissue of rats Ganoderma lucidum peptide 27.1 μg/mL Malondialdehyde level Antioxidant Substantial antioxidant activity in the rat liver tissue homogenates and mitochondrial membrane peroxidation systems [87]

14 Lupus mice Ganoderma tsugae 0.5 mg/kg/day Decreased proteinuria, decreased serum levels of antidsDNA autoantibody Prevention of autoantibody Prevention of autoantibody formation [88]
